Suchen |
Kategorien |
|
|
|
|
|
| Wie kann man die Pruefziffer eines EAN13 in Excel berechnen? |
|
Artikel Details
Aktualisiert 16th of December, 2009
|
Über ein Makro "GetEAN" mit folgendem Inhalt:
Function GetEAN(cWert As String) As Integer
Dim x As Integer, nSumme As Integer, nLang As Integer Dim lGerade As Boolean
nLang = Len(cWert) lGerade = True For x = 1 To nLang lGerade = Not lGerade If lGerade Then nSumme = nSumme + Val(Mid$(cWert, x, 1)) * 3 Else nSumme = nSumme + Val(Mid$(cWert, x, 1)) * 1 End If Next x GetEAN = Int((nSumme + 9) / 10) * 10 - nSumme
End Function FN 2003-06-30
|